Можно ли назначать звуки системных событий в Ubuntu 14.04 вместо системных звуков по умолчанию?
Мне было интересно, есть ли способ использовать пользовательские звуки системных событий в Ubuntu 14.04?
Единственные настройки, доступные на вкладке "Настройки системы" → "Звуки", являются темой по умолчанию.
Если это так, нужно ли это редактировать вручную, или есть приложение, которое может получить доступ и изменить звуки системных событий по умолчанию? Спасибо за любую помощь заранее.
2 ответа
Предположение: мы говорим об Ubuntu (т.е. Gnome/Unity) 14.04, здесь не Kubuntu/Xubuntu/Lubuntu.
Мне было довольно сложно найти однозначный ответ о том, как звуковые темы должны работать в Ubuntu, но вот что я понял.
- Звуковые темы находятся в папках под
/usr/share/sounds
(так что, если вы хотите добавить загруженную звуковую тему, вы должны извлечь ее) - Они содержат
index.theme
файл и подпапки, содержащие звуки (я видел толькоstereo
папка) - Это часть спецификации Freedesktop.
Вы можете изменить текущую активную тему, используя dconf Editor - просто перейдите к /org/gnome/desktop/sound/theme-name
,
Или вы можете сделать то же самое в командной строке (или в скрипте):
gsettings set org.gnome.desktop.sound theme-name "ubuntu"
Хорошо после некоторого исследования, в основном я узнал... Вещи больше не работают этим путем. В основном каждая программа или часть программы в некоторых случаях должна контролировать свои собственные настройки, включая любые звуковые оповещения. В принципе невозможно иметь программу, которая взаимодействует и может диктовать каждую часть пользовательского интерфейса. Некоторые из них легко найти, большинство нет. Просто найти настройки для них, скажем, в вашем файловом менеджере, может быть невозможно! Мои вещи изменились за 10 лет. По сути, так устроен ALSA, и большинство систем Buntu его используют. Так что это не ошибка! Это особенность!